Output 81916bd0d7ccff61f6a1889104fe4cde0e355a16ee0ee3c8fb775139fc2ea8f9:0

value
176000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c9bc244080de09560a6b0c2039f87a9309ab557 OP_EQUAL
address
MR6RrosdzRTxwwFAvFuEw57zieMqZSHMvp
transaction
81916bd0d7ccff61f6a1889104fe4cde0e355a16ee0ee3c8fb775139fc2ea8f9
spent
true